Vascular Access Devices – Market Insights – Europe
The European vascular access device market is well-established and will grow marginally over the forecast period. Unit sales will be supported by steady growth in the underlying patient population undergoing medical procedures that require vascular access; however, the maturity of the vascular access device market has resulted in strong downward pressures on ASPs that will somewhat inhibit revenue expansion.
This Medtech 360 Report provides comprehensive data and analysis on the state of the market for vascular access devices in Europe from 2019 through 2032.
